Transaction 523d9116a2a987d405942823c3f898f263b7e112fc4fac71e3cb91c2857c821e

1 Input
2 Outputs
  • 523d9116a2a987d405942823c3f898f263b7e112fc4fac71e3cb91c2857c821e:0
  • value  414700
    address  18CGijUJd1VXC4mnPFDqTUhfMgRJ516kHb
  • 523d9116a2a987d405942823c3f898f263b7e112fc4fac71e3cb91c2857c821e:1
  • value  15571
    address  163aTj15zoQiLDdgPARZp6EMRVgdxfudVE